Kirovohrad Oblast facts for kids
Kirovohrad Oblast is a region, or oblast, located in the central part of Ukraine. Think of an oblast like a large province or state within a country. Its main city and administrative center is Kropyvnytskyi. In 2013, about 991,600 people lived in Kirovohrad Oblast. This area is important for Ukraine because of its central location.

What is an Oblast?
An oblast is a type of administrative division used in Ukraine and some other countries. It's similar to a state in the United States or a province in Canada. Each oblast has its own government and helps manage the region. Ukraine is divided into 24 such oblasts, plus the Autonomous Republic of Crimea and two special cities.
